I’ve found a few reliable spots to catch ongoing stories in PDF format. Websites like Wuxiaworld and Royal Road often update their content regularly, though they primarily host online reading. For PDFs, sites like NovelUpdates aggregate links to translators’ Google Drive or Dropbox folders where they share downloadable chapters. Some translators even post on Patreon with PDF releases for supporters.

Another great option is Scribd, where users upload PDFs of ongoing translations, though availability depends on the novel’s popularity. For officially licensed works, platforms like J-Novel Club offer premium memberships with downloadable PDFs of their serials. If you’re into Chinese web novels, check out Webnovel’s community forums—fans sometimes compile PDFs of ongoing works. Just remember to support authors and translators when possible!

Can I get pdf files for free of ongoing web novels?

3 Answers2025-08-04 18:41:14
I totally get the urge to find free PDFs, especially for ongoing series. The reality is, most official translations or original works don’t release free PDFs because it hurts the authors and publishers. Sites like Wuxiaworld or Webnovel often have free chapters, but you’ll hit paywalls. Some fan translations circulate as PDFs, but they’re usually unofficial and taken down fast. I’ve found a few gems on Scribd or Archive.org, but they’re rare. If you love a series, supporting the creators via Patreon or official platforms ensures they keep writing. It’s a bummer, but pirated copies often mean fewer updates or dropped projects.
